  2. How to Play Like Ma Long: Secrets to Chinese Coaching (Not Clickbait)

    The use of the wrist is to generate more spin, it adds some power, but really it’s for spin. power is produced primarily by the hip and chest turn and weight transfer (for a right handed player) weight is transferred from the right leg to the left as the hips and chest turn back towards the...
